Excerpt from American Wild Flowers in Their Native Haunts The botanical and local descriptions accompanying the plates, have been furnished by the artist, Mr. E. Whitefield. The verses, begin ning She sleeps. Inserted in Love beyond the Grave, were presented for publication by a friend. With these exceptions, the author is alone responsible for every thing in the volume which has not the name of its writer affixed. To the friends who have assisted her in this undertaking, she would fain offer her heart-warm thanks. Of the high value of their aid, every intelligent reader can judge, but of the spontaneous kind ness with which that aid was afforded, this is not the place to speak, since it would be invading the rights and encroaching upon the privi leges of that friendship which claims to belong to social, even more than to literary life. It is only necessary to add that every thing contained in the volume was written expressly for it, with the exception of a few short poems, selected from the author's early writings, which after appearing under other Signatures, are now for the first time claimed.
